1. surface of said digitizer tablet..]. 4. A stylus for use with a digitizer tablet having a working surface, comprising:

  • a tip for pressing against the working surface of said digitizer tablet;

    a transducer having electrical resistance, said resistance varying with the amount of compressive force applied to said transducer;

    a pair of electrodes conductively contacting said transducer and in electrical circuit with said variable resistance when said compressive force is applied; and

    mechanical means for transmitting to said transducer a compressive force substantially equal to the pressure being exerted on the working surface of said tablet by said tip, whereby the resistance of said transducer is a function of said pressure, said transducer including a layer of conductive ink having a resistance which changes as a function of the compressive force applied thereon, each of said electrodes including a layer of conductive ink which is electrically connected to said transducer when said tip is pressed against the working surface of said digitizer tablet, said layer of conductive ink of said transducer being applied on a first plastic backing layer and said layer of conductive ink of said electrodes being applied on a second plastic backing layer, said first and second
